Verdict

Despite initial stamina concerns, MAKBULLET has taken well to hurdles and is proving particularly effective on this track. He was always travelling like a winner when successful over a longer trip here last time and looks capable of defying his double penalty. Keeneland didn't beat much at Perth last month but is open to more improvement than recent Bangor second Cavite Eta while, though well beaten, Shisha Threesixty will have learned plenty from his run behind Lexi's Boy at Ayr. Nemi can also step up on his hurdles debut here earlier in the month as he had some decent form in bumpers.
